I really wanted to have a play with my CraftArtist 2 and this Fishy Bulb image from The Stamping Chef gave me the perfect opportunity.  I imported the image into the program and had a play with the cutout studio, punches and styles.  I have used several layers in the program to achieve this page and I printed it out and stuck it to some greyboard I then attached a big clip to the top.  I plan on using it as a place to put the letters etc I need to deal with.  I've pictured it nice and big in the hope you can see the effects on the light bulb.  A metal top, a smooth glass effect underneath the top and a glass effect with a ripple for the water.  I then had to make the fish into a punch so I could cut out the material I wanted and then put the image back over it.  I've still not quite got it right but I'm really please with the work.

I was commenting on Crafting Vicky's blog and the theme of the challenge she had made her DT card for was "warm thoughts" over at Digi Makeover Challenge.  A little pouch that I saw a tutorial for many years ago sprang to mind.  The tutorial is by Paul over at Crafty Blogocks.  The one I've made is a bit different but the principle is the same.

I used my CraftArtist program and the digikit Cocoa Latte to print out the card on both sides then I printed and cut out an embellie to put on the front, when I've more time to play I will have a go at printing it onto the back of the card.  I can get 2 pouches out of 1 A4 piece of card.  Now I've made this up I think next time I will make slots in the slope instead of 1 oval and insert 3 or 4 sachets of hot chocolate and maybe some tiny marshmallows.  When I find my hook and loop tape I will put a small piece on to hold the flap in place.

The image I chose to use is Maggie. She reminds me of the showgirls you see in the saloons in the old Western films.  I can see her on the stage of Deadwood (Calamity Jane reference).

I have cut my card into a diamond shape, not as easy as it looks for me, getting the right dimensions took some doing.  The base card and mats are are from Rymans it's 200gsm, cream, coated card and the DP is another sheet from my K and Co 12 x 12 pad.  Circles of the paper and card were inked with fired brick DI and rolled into flowers and stuck on with my glue gun.  Boy does that glue get everywhere.  The image was coloured with Copic markers.  I will choose a sentiment later when I find them all so I can choose the right one.

Krista is giving away 2 images, to the Winner, from her wonderful store.  Krista was kind enough to let us choose our image for this challenge and I chose Pearl because I wanted to do The Little Mermaid (yes I went with the Disney version but I do love her hair).

I coloured my image with Distressed Inks and used a spellbinder die to cut it out as well as some swirls.  The ribbon is from Craft Den and the papers are from a 360 page pad by K and Co.  I never thought I would use paper but as soon as I saw this image I knew it would work.  The pearls were made with a Viva Pearl Pen and it only took me 2 goes to get it right.  The first lot I made I put my hand in, as usual but the second lot I managed to let dry without incident.  I also put some glaze drops in her hair.

The image I chose from Dilly Beans is 415 - Pinkys skull bow and I really enjoyed colouring this and let go with several colours of brown on the hair.  I find this a hard thing to do as I always think it looks messy but this image just seemed to lend itself to the technique.  The papers and card are all from my stash as is the ribbon and gems.  I used Promarkers for the image and Uni Paint marker for the skulls and image background.
